The Evolution of Financial Technology
To truly appreciate epcylon, we have to look at where we came from. Financial markets used to be physical places where people shouted orders at each other. Then came the computer age, allowing for electronic trading. Now, we are in the age of algorithmic and AI trading.
From Manual to Digital
In the past, trading was a manual process. You had to call a broker, who would then place an order. It was slow and prone to errors. The introduction of computers sped things up, but decisions were still largely human-driven.
The Rise of Algorithms
Then came algorithms. These are sets of rules that computers follow. For example, “If stock X drops to $50, buy it.” This automated the process but was still rigid. It couldn’t adapt to new information easily.
The Era of AI and Epcylon
This is where epcylon enters the picture. Unlike basic algorithms, AI-driven systems learn. They adapt. If the market changes behavior, the system updates its strategy. This evolution marks a massive shift from static rules to dynamic, learning systems.

The Role of Predictive Analytics
Predictive analytics is a subset of AI that focuses specifically on forecasting future outcomes. In the world of epcylon, this is crucial. It’s about answering the question: “What is likely to happen next?”
Historical Data Analysis
The system looks at decades of past market data. It identifies scenarios that look similar to the current market environment. History doesn’t repeat itself exactly, but it often rhymes.
Pattern Recognition
Markets move in waves and cycles. Predictive analytics identifies these patterns. Whether it is a “head and shoulders” pattern on a chart or a cyclical seasonal trend, the software spots it instantly.
Sentiment Analysis
This is a newer and very powerful tool. The system scans the internet—news sites, Twitter, Reddit—to gauge how people feel about a certain asset. Is the buzz positive or negative? This “sentiment” is a leading indicator of price movement.

Risk Management Capabilities
Making money is great, but keeping it is harder. This is where risk management comes in. A human trader might hold onto a losing stock because they hope it will come back up. This is called the “sunk cost fallacy.”
Epcylon systems do not have hope; they have math. If a trade hits a certain loss threshold, the system cuts it loose immediately. It calculates the “Risk to Reward” ratio for every single action.
Furthermore, it manages portfolio diversity. It ensures that you aren’t overexposed to one sector. If the tech sector crashes, the system ensures your portfolio is balanced with healthcare or utilities to cushion the blow.
Epcylon in Cryptocurrency Markets
The volatility of cryptocurrency makes it a perfect playground for AI. Crypto markets never sleep; they run 24/7. No human can watch a market for 24 hours a day, 7 days a week. But software can.
Handling Volatility
Crypto prices can swing 20% in a single day. Epcylon algorithms thrive here. They can take advantage of these massive swings, buying the dips and selling the peaks faster than a human can click a mouse.
Arbitrage Opportunities
Because crypto trades on hundreds of different exchanges, the price of Bitcoin might be slightly different on Exchange A versus Exchange B. Automated systems can spot this difference and buy on the cheaper exchange while selling on the expensive one, making an instant, risk-free profit.

The Human Element: Why We Still Need People
![]()
With all this talk of automation, you might wonder if humans are becoming obsolete. The answer is no. Epcylon is a tool, not a replacement for human judgment.
Strategy Oversight
Humans still need to set the overall strategy. We decide the risk tolerance, the goals, and the ethical boundaries. The AI executes the strategy, but the human is the architect.
“Black Swan” Events
AI relies on data. If something happens that has never happened before (a “Black Swan” event), AI can get confused. Humans are better at navigating completely novel situations where intuition and context are required.
Ethical Considerations
Computers don’t have morals. A human is needed to ensure that trading practices are ethical and comply with regulations.
